Subtitle: "The Official Publication of the Canadian Olympic Association." Oversize Hardcover. 9.5" wide by 12.5" tall. Bound in the original purple cloth, stamped in shiny silver and gold on the spine and front cover. Housed in a matching purple cloth slipcase with a pastedown photo of the Torch from the 1988 XV Olympic Games. Lavishly illustrated with photographs throughout, most in beautiful full-color. Text is in both English and French. Included are gorgeous action photos and narrative accounts of the exploits of Alberto Tomba, Brian Boitano, Katarina Witt, Bonnie Blair, etc. There is a statistical section with medal counts by country; the times/scores of all the top competitors in Calgary (i.e. NOT just the medal winners); plus lists of past winners in each event from all Olympic Games 1908 - 1988.
